refactor(switches): standardize all switch names to <site>-<rack>-<function>-<NN>
Rename all 5 switches across all layers (DNS, DHCP, device hostname, conman console, ser2net, udev symlinks, repo files) to follow the <site>-<rack>-<function>-<count> convention: pfv-core-sw01 → pfv-r5-core-01 (rack 5 core) pfv-tor3-mgmt → pfv-r3-tor-mgmt-01 (rack 3 mgmt TOR) pfv-tor3-stor → pfv-r3-tor-stor-01 (rack 3 storage TOR) pfv-r2-tor-top → pfv-r2-tor-01 (rack 2 TOR) subodev-torsw01 → pfv-r6-mgmt-01 (rack 6 mgmt) Dead switch (pfv-r2-sw, port 2007) removed from mapping.txt. pfv-rrinfra-rtr unchanged (router, not a switch). Device hostnames changed via conman. Configs regenerated on pfv-tsys4. All .cmds files, validate-conman.sh, and AGENTS.md updated. [#369] 💘 Generated with Crush Assisted-by: Crush:glm-5.2
